View moreThe Department of the Air Force, specifically the 82nd Contracting Squadron at Sheppard Air Force Base, Texas, has issued solicitation FA302020Q0062 for recreational sports officiating services. This requirement is a total Small Business Set-Aside (SBA) classified under NAICS code 711219, Other Spectator Sports, and PSC G003, Social-Recreational. The contractor will provide qualified personnel and necessary officiating equipment—such as uniforms, whistles, penalty flags, and soccer cards—to support intramural and varsity sports programs. These programs serve active duty military, dependents age 18 and older, Department of Defense and Non-Appropriated Fund employees, retired personnel, and contract employees. Although the government provides primary game equipment like balls, goals, and scoreboards, the contractor is responsible for all items required to perform officiating duties according to industry standards.
The scope of this indefinite quantity contract includes officiating and scorekeeping for several sports: intramural basketball (180 games), intramural volleyball (130 games), intramural softball (180 games), intramural soccer (70 games), intramural flag football (130 games), and varsity basketball (30 games). Performance will occur at various locations on Sheppard Air Force Base, including the Levitow Fitness Center, Pitsenbarger Fitness Center, softball fields, and multi-purpose fields. This combined synopsis/solicitation was published on September 16, 2020, with an updated response deadline of October 5, 2020. Casey Adams is the designated point of contact.
This acquisition is subject to the availability of funds, and no award will be made until funding is secured. The solicitation includes four attachments: two versions of a price sheet in Excel format, a combined solicitation document, and the performance work statement. Offerors are required to submit quotes using the provided spreadsheet tabs. The government reserves the right to cancel the solicitation at any time without obligation to reimburse offerors for proposal costs. Detailed contract clauses regarding the indefinite quantity nature of the requirement are included in the solicitation documentation.
